I can't make a comparison, because I have never used Rocksim. But OpenRocket is a pretty amazing free program. I've mostly used it after building a rocket to determine stability and whether nose weight is required, speed off the rod/rail for safe launches, projected altitude, and optimal delay. One field I fly at has a G motor limit and 1,000 foot ceiling. So for some rockets, I've used it to be sure I get close to 1,000 feet but don't go over. And for larger HPR rockets on that field, I've used it to find G motors that will safely lift the rocket and the appropriate delays, which are sometimes surprisingly short.
